Helps you craft amazing post URL slugs, for that hand-crafted URL feel.

## Description ##

Isn't it annoying when you craft a post title, and then the URL slug kind of falls short? Like, if your title is **Breaking: Yankees win 3-2 in extra innings. I'm excited & literally can't even** and your post slug turns out like **breaking-yankees-win-3-2-in-extra-innings-im-excited-literally-cant-even**. "3-2" is ambiguous because all the words are already separated by dashes. "im" is not a word. "cant" means something else. The ampersand meaning "and" just got dropped. The leading "breaking-" will be silly when the date part of the URL is 3 years old. The whole URL is off. Doesn't this make more sense? **yankees-win-3-to-2-in-extra-innings-i-am-excited-and-literally-cannot-even**. Sure it's really long (and a future version of the plugin will help with that!), but it reads much better.

## Installation ##

Search for "Slug Control" and install it.

### Manual Installation ###

1. Upload the entire `/cws-slug-control` directory to the `/wp-content/plugins/` directory.
2. Activate Slug Control through the 'Plugins' menu in WordPress.
